排序
Android平台GB28181设备接入模块之按需编码和双码流编码
技术背景 我们在做执法记录仪或指挥系统的时候,会遇到这样的情况,大多场景下,我们是不需要把设备端的数据,实时传给国标平台端的,默认只需要本地录像留底,如果指挥中心需要查看前端设备...
Android录制视频,硬编API实现录制的几种方式
通过系统API实现录制的几种方案与简单的使用 前言 关于如何使用视频录制,之前也讲到过可以有多种方式实现,Intent 跳转系统页面,FFmpeg之类的软编,以及 CameraX 封装的硬编码实现,MediaReco...
详解TCP网络协议栈的工作原理
本文分享自华为云社区《网络通信的神奇之旅:解密Linux TCP网络协议栈的工作原理》,作者: Lion Long 。 一、TCP网络开发API TCP,全称传输控制协议(Transmission Control Protocol),是一种...
GB28181设备接入端如何播放语音广播数据?
技术背景 语音广播功能是GB28181设备接入端非常重要的功能属性,语音广播让终端和平台之间,有了实时双向互动,可以满足执法记录仪、智能安全帽、智能监控、智慧零售、智慧教育、远程办公、...
构建 WebRTC for IOS AppRTCMobile 项目
简介 在之前的几篇文章中,我们已经学习了如何在 Web、Windows 和 Android 平台上封装和建立一个 P2P 和 P2PS 音视频通话项目。然而,我们还没有讨论在 Linux 和 iOS 平台上如何操作。因此,这...
初探 HTML video 视频字幕
什么是外挂字幕? 我们在观看 电视、电影 时能够看到在播放区域下方,会展示与视频中人物说话所对应的字幕。字幕给观影者看不懂的内容提供了翻译。比如英文电影里能够展示中文字幕。 早期很多视...
GB28181设备接入侧如何支持H.265?
技术背景 一直以来,GB28181-2022之前的规范版本让人诟病的一点:没有明确针对H.265的说明,特别是监控摄像机,H.265已然成为标配,GB/T28181-2022规范,终于针对H.265做了明确的说明,让我们来...
【网易云信】直播场景播放侧常见问题分析与实践经验
常见的播放流程 播放器主要流程分析 播放器的播放流程与推流过程类似,但是顺序相反。 推流端先采集音频和视频,进行音视频编码和封装,并按照流媒体协议进行处理,最终得到输出流。而播放器则...
Android中高级进阶开发面试题冲刺合集(六)
持续创作,加速成长!这是我参与「掘金日新计划 · 10 月更文挑战」的第2天,点击查看活动详情 以下主要针对往期收录的面试题进行一个分类归纳整理,方便大家统一回顾和参考。本篇是第六集~ 强...
用JavaScript五分钟开发一个文本转智能语音的应用
在详细讲解之前,先看看最终的效果: 这个简单的应用只需要几分钟时间,你也可以搞定。 语音合成服务 语音合成服务有多种选择,比如阿里云、百度AI开放平台,AWS、七牛云等等,这里我选择的是七...
GB28181设备接入侧录像查询和录像下载技术探究之实时录像
技术背景 我们在对接GB28181设备接入侧的时候,除了常规实时音视频按需上传外,还有个重要的功能,就是本地实时录像,录像后的数据,在执法记录仪等前端设备留底,然后,到工作站拷贝到专门的平...
Unity平台如何实现RTSP转RTMP推送?
技术背景 Unity平台下,RTSP、RTMP播放和RTMP推送,甚至包括轻量级RTSP服务这块都不再赘述,今天探讨的一位开发者提到的问题,如果在Unity下,实现RTSP播放的同时,随时转RTMP推送出去? RTSP转...
09-?音视频技术核心知识|视频编码解码【了解H.264编码、H.264编码、H.264编码解码】
一、前言 顺应时代的技术发展潮流,逐步学习并掌握音视频技术核心知识,让技术落地,让知识赋能生活,让科技造福千万灯火。 二、 H.264编码 本文主要介绍一种非常流行的视频编码:H.264。 计算...
10-?音视频技术核心知识|RTMP服务器搭建【流媒体、服务器环境】
一、前言 顺应时代的技术发展潮流,逐步学习并掌握音视频技术核心知识,让技术落地,让知识赋能生活,让科技造福千万灯火。 二、流媒体 1. 基本概念 流媒体(Streaming media),也叫做:流式媒...
08-?音视频技术核心知识|成像技术【重识图片、详解YUV、视频录制、显示BMP图片、显示YUV图片】
一、前言 顺应时代的技术发展潮流,逐步学习并掌握音视频技术核心知识,让技术落地,让知识赋能生活,让科技造福千万灯火。 二、重识图片 要想学好音视频,首先得先好好研究一下图片。 1. 像素 ...
06-?音视频技术核心知识|音频重采样【音频重采样简介、用命令行进行重采样、通过编程重采样】
一、前言 顺应时代的技术发展潮流,逐步学习并掌握音视频技术核心知识,让技术落地,让知识赋能生活,让科技造福千万灯火。 二、音频重采样简介 1. 什么叫音频重采样 音频重采样(Audio Resampl...
07-?音视频技术核心知识|AAC编码【AAC编码器解码器、编译FFmpeg、AAC编码实战、AAC解码实战】
一、前言 顺应时代的技术发展潮流,逐步学习并掌握音视频技术核心知识,让技术落地,让知识赋能生活,让科技造福千万灯火。 二、AAC编码 AAC(Advanced Audio Coding,译为:高级音频编码),是...
05-?音视频技术核心知识|音频播放【播放PCM、WAV、PCM转WAV、PCM转WAV、播放WAV】
一、前言 顺应时代的技术发展潮流,逐步学习并掌握音视频技术核心知识,让技术落地,让知识赋能生活,让科技造福千万灯火。
01-?音视频技术核心知识|了解音频技术【移动通信技术的发展、声音的本质、深入了解音频】
一、前言 1. 关于声音的浪漫传说 历史浩瀚如烟海,人类文明走了几千年来到了今天。在这几千年里,有各种各样美丽的传说,在那些遥远的传说里,其中就不乏与声音有关的传说: 《梁山伯与祝英台》 ...
02-?音视频技术核心知识|搭建开发环境【FFmpeg与Qt、Windows开发环境搭建、Mac开发环境搭建、Qt开发基础】
一、前言 顺应时代的技术发展潮流,逐步学习并掌握音视频技术核心知识,让技术落地,让知识赋能生活,让科技造福千万灯火。 二、FFmpeg与Qt 1. 为什么选择FFmpeg? 每个主流平台基本都有自己的...